Nd: YAG Leg Vein Removal

Effective Laser Treatment for Leg Veins

There are many different kinds of light energy, ranging over a broad spectrum of wavelengths. White light is visible to the human eye, as well as the 7 prominent colours of the rainbow. However, when it comes to medical applications, the IR spectrum is commonly used. Infrared Radiation (IR) includes specific wavelengths that are used for medical applications. In some cases, these specific wavelengths are incorporated into medical laser systems, which is the case with the Palomar Nd: YAG 1064 hand-held device.

To produce a concentrated wavelength and be able to fire it, a laser would normally feature a crystal. The Palomar Nd: YAG 1064 system is one of the most advanced on the market today. It features a neodymium-doped yttrium aluminium garnet crystal that fires a 1064-nm wavelength of energy. This specific wavelength falls under the IR spectrum, being classified as infrared light. This device is used to target visible leg veins with the purpose of reducing their visibility on the surface of the skin. When light energy penetrates the skin, it is mostly converted into heat energy, dependent on the type of light energy being absorbed.

How Does the Palomar Nd: YAG 1064 Work for Leg Veins?

The Palomar hand-held device is designed to deliver a comfortable form of laser treatment. With a sapphire treatment tip and an advanced cooling system, the surface of your skin will stay cool during treatment. Once the 1064-nm wavelength hits the skin, it passes through the initial surface to target the visible leg vein directly. The energy is converted to heat once it hits the vein, causing the blood in the vein to heat up. The heated blood will cause the vessel to constrict, leading to the vein shrinking, darkening, or disappearing once the treated area is fully healed.

The treated area will be slightly swollen and turn pink, which will prevail for 24 hours after the treatment. Therefore, we advise against any waxing, hair plucking, and bleaching on the intended area for 4 weeks before the scheduled treatment. You will require a consultation before-hand as well. Should you be on antibiotics or Cortisone, we suggest that you wait 2 weeks after finishing your course before considering treatment. Therefore, your body will be in optimal shape to deal with the recovery process.
